Demons Announce Strength And Conditioning Coach
Posted on the 17th February 2012 by Patrick
Northampton Demons are proud to announce their new strength and conditioning coach for the 2012 season in Michael Peacock from Pure Performance Strength and Conditioning Services
Michael has over 10 years experience in Sports, Health and Fitness having played County and semi professional football and representing Cambridgeshire Minor Counties Cricket Club.
After several years in the industry Michael’s passion, enthusiasm and philosophies for creating the complete athlete led him to go to University in Cambridge to obtain a degree in Sport and Exercise Science. During his time at University, Michael gained an internship with the Lawn Tennis Association (LTA) at a High Performance Centre in Cambridge. This internship continued to employment for the next 18 months as a Strength & Conditioning Coach and is now Lead S&C at Bishops Stortford Lawn Tennis Club.
Michael also spent 2010-2011 pre-season as an intern at League One side Leyton Orient FC assisting in the deliverance of all aspects of the first teams training program and has spent time with the Arsenal Reserve Team & Academy Fitness Coach.
Still striving for more knowledge and education in all sports he gained more experience with Northampton Saints Rugby Club as an S&C Coach intern for the Cambridge based players within their Elite Professional Development Group (EPDG). This again has continued and he coached the whole U 16 Elite Professional Development Group through their pre-season with the guidance of the Strength & Conditioning Coaches at the club.
On joining The Northampton Demons:
“It’s a fantastic opportunity to join a great rugby league club. After meeting with Joe and sharing his passion and enthusiasm for success, I’m looking forward to working with Joe and sharing the challenge of making the Demons a Championship winning side again. Pre-season’s going to be tough but with the aim of winning the championship again strength and fitness levels have to be high and be maintained throughout the season.”
